diff options
Diffstat (limited to 'rec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ch')
-rw-r--r-- | rec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ch b/rec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ch index 4d1df8a..d00b73a 100644 --- a/rec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ch +++ b/recipes-core/openjdk/patches-openjdk-8/2002-jdk-Allow-using-a-system-installed-libjpeg.patch | |||
@@ -1,7 +1,7 @@ | |||
1 | From aef9a3f955f6e189b2a24b9f79ccb396275d4fa3 Mon Sep 17 00:00:00 2001 | 1 | From bd5665d4aa962107eb3d51d20d8b8971d9fca044 Mon Sep 17 00:00:00 2001 |
2 | From: =?UTF-8?q?Andr=C3=A9=20Draszik?= <andre.draszik@jci.com> | 2 | From: =?UTF-8?q?Andr=C3=A9=20Draszik?= <andre.draszik@jci.com> |
3 | Date: Tue, 27 Feb 2018 13:36:53 +0000 | 3 | Date: Tue, 27 Feb 2018 13:36:53 +0000 |
4 | Subject: [PATCH 2002/2008] jdk: Allow using a system-installed libjpeg | 4 | Subject: [PATCH 2002/2009] jdk: Allow using a system-installed libjpeg |
5 | MIME-Version: 1.0 | 5 | MIME-Version: 1.0 |
6 | Content-Type: text/plain; charset=UTF-8 | 6 | Content-Type: text/plain; charset=UTF-8 |
7 | Content-Transfer-Encoding: 8bit | 7 | Content-Transfer-Encoding: 8bit |
@@ -30,10 +30,10 @@ Signed-off-by: Richard Leitner <richard.leitner@skidata.com> | |||
30 | 5 files changed, 51 insertions(+), 26 deletions(-) | 30 | 5 files changed, 51 insertions(+), 26 deletions(-) |
31 | 31 | ||
32 | diff --git a/jdk/make/lib/Awt2dLibraries.gmk b/jdk/make/lib/Awt2dLibraries.gmk | 32 | diff --git a/jdk/make/lib/Awt2dLibraries.gmk b/jdk/make/lib/Awt2dLibraries.gmk |
33 | index a06bfd6db..12b9da11d 100644 | 33 | index 9368a9d508..7fffcafc70 100644 |
34 | --- a/jdk/make/lib/Awt2dLibraries.gmk | 34 | --- a/jdk/make/lib/Awt2dLibraries.gmk |
35 | +++ b/jdk/make/lib/Awt2dLibraries.gmk | 35 | +++ b/jdk/make/lib/Awt2dLibraries.gmk |
36 | @@ -695,21 +695,24 @@ $(BUILD_LIBLCMS): $(BUILD_LIBAWT) | 36 | @@ -702,21 +702,24 @@ $(BUILD_LIBLCMS): $(BUILD_LIBAWT) |
37 | 37 | ||
38 | ########################################################################################## | 38 | ########################################################################################## |
39 | 39 | ||
@@ -64,7 +64,7 @@ index a06bfd6db..12b9da11d 100644 | |||
64 | # Suppress gcc warnings like "variable might be clobbered by 'longjmp' | 64 | # Suppress gcc warnings like "variable might be clobbered by 'longjmp' |
65 | # or 'vfork'": this warning indicates that some variable is placed to | 65 | # or 'vfork'": this warning indicates that some variable is placed to |
66 | # a register by optimized compiler and it's value might be lost on longjmp(). | 66 | # a register by optimized compiler and it's value might be lost on longjmp(). |
67 | @@ -721,37 +724,50 @@ endif | 67 | @@ -728,37 +731,50 @@ endif |
68 | # $(shell $(EXPR) $(CC_MAJORVER) \> 4 \| \ | 68 | # $(shell $(EXPR) $(CC_MAJORVER) \> 4 \| \ |
69 | # \( $(CC_MAJORVER) = 4 \& $(CC_MINORVER) \>= 3 \) ) | 69 | # \( $(CC_MAJORVER) = 4 \& $(CC_MINORVER) \>= 3 \) ) |
70 | # ifeq ($(CC_43_OR_NEWER), 1) | 70 | # ifeq ($(CC_43_OR_NEWER), 1) |
@@ -129,7 +129,7 @@ index a06bfd6db..12b9da11d 100644 | |||
129 | 129 | ||
130 | ########################################################################################## | 130 | ########################################################################################## |
131 | 131 | ||
132 | @@ -1142,6 +1158,13 @@ ifndef BUILD_HEADLESS_ONLY | 132 | @@ -1149,6 +1165,13 @@ ifndef BUILD_HEADLESS_ONLY |
133 | GIFLIB_CFLAGS := -I$(JDK_TOPDIR)/src/share/native/sun/awt/giflib | 133 | GIFLIB_CFLAGS := -I$(JDK_TOPDIR)/src/share/native/sun/awt/giflib |
134 | endif | 134 | endif |
135 | 135 | ||
@@ -143,7 +143,7 @@ index a06bfd6db..12b9da11d 100644 | |||
143 | ifneq ($(OPENJDK_TARGET_OS), macosx) | 143 | ifneq ($(OPENJDK_TARGET_OS), macosx) |
144 | LIBSPLASHSCREEN_DIRS += $(JDK_TOPDIR)/src/$(OPENJDK_TARGET_OS_API_DIR)/native/sun/awt/splashscreen | 144 | LIBSPLASHSCREEN_DIRS += $(JDK_TOPDIR)/src/$(OPENJDK_TARGET_OS_API_DIR)/native/sun/awt/splashscreen |
145 | else | 145 | else |
146 | @@ -1198,11 +1221,13 @@ ifndef BUILD_HEADLESS_ONLY | 146 | @@ -1205,11 +1228,13 @@ ifndef BUILD_HEADLESS_ONLY |
147 | EXCLUDE_FILES := imageioJPEG.c jpegdecoder.c pngtest.c, \ | 147 | EXCLUDE_FILES := imageioJPEG.c jpegdecoder.c pngtest.c, \ |
148 | LANG := C, \ | 148 | LANG := C, \ |
149 | OPTIMIZATION := LOW, \ | 149 | OPTIMIZATION := LOW, \ |
@@ -160,7 +160,7 @@ index a06bfd6db..12b9da11d 100644 | |||
160 | VERSIONINFO_RESOURCE := $(JDK_TOPDIR)/src/windows/resource/version.rc, \ | 160 | VERSIONINFO_RESOURCE := $(JDK_TOPDIR)/src/windows/resource/version.rc, \ |
161 | RC_FLAGS := $(RC_FLAGS) \ | 161 | RC_FLAGS := $(RC_FLAGS) \ |
162 | diff --git a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java | 162 | diff --git a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java |
163 | index 8f58f5b3e..fcbab8260 100644 | 163 | index 8f58f5b3e6..fcbab82602 100644 |
164 | --- a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java | 164 | --- a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java |
165 | +++ b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java | 165 | +++ b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ageReader.java |
166 | @@ -89,7 +89,7 @@ public class JPEGImageReader extends ImageReader { | 166 | @@ -89,7 +89,7 @@ public class JPEGImageReader extends ImageReader { |
@@ -173,7 +173,7 @@ index 8f58f5b3e..fcbab8260 100644 | |||
173 | } | 173 | } |
174 | }); | 174 | }); |
175 | diff --git a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java | 175 | diff --git a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java |
176 | index 6a33bd5a1..dca189ed8 100644 | 176 | index 6a33bd5a15..dca189ed85 100644 |
177 | --- a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java | 177 | --- a/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java |
178 | +++ b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java | 178 | +++ b/jdk/src/share/classes/com/sun/imageio/plugins/jpeg/JPEGImageWriter.java |
179 | @@ -177,7 +177,7 @@ public class JPEGImageWriter extends ImageWriter { | 179 | @@ -177,7 +177,7 @@ public class JPEGImageWriter extends ImageWriter { |
@@ -186,7 +186,7 @@ index 6a33bd5a1..dca189ed8 100644 | |||
186 | } | 186 | } |
187 | }); | 187 | }); |
188 | diff --git a/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java b/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java | 188 | diff --git a/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java b/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java |
189 | index 872ffc019..5965a186b 100644 | 189 | index 872ffc0197..5965a186b9 100644 |
190 | --- a/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java | 190 | --- a/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java |
191 | +++ b/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java | 191 | +++ b/jdk/src/share/classes/sun/awt/image/JPEGImageDecoder.java |
192 | @@ -56,7 +56,7 @@ public class JPEGImageDecoder extends ImageDecoder { | 192 | @@ -56,7 +56,7 @@ public class JPEGImageDecoder extends ImageDecoder { |
@@ -199,7 +199,7 @@ index 872ffc019..5965a186b 100644 | |||
199 | } | 199 | } |
200 | }); | 200 | }); |
201 | diff --git a/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c b/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c | 201 | diff --git a/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c b/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c |
202 | index 7e1d8c99d..8cac61da3 100644 | 202 | index 7e1d8c99d7..8cac61da32 100644 |
203 | --- a/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c | 203 | --- a/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c |
204 | +++ b/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c | 204 | +++ b/jdk/src/share/native/sun/awt/image/jpeg/imageioJPEG.c |
205 | @@ -51,7 +51,7 @@ | 205 | @@ -51,7 +51,7 @@ |
@@ -212,5 +212,5 @@ index 7e1d8c99d..8cac61da3 100644 | |||
212 | #undef MAX | 212 | #undef MAX |
213 | #define MAX(a,b) ((a) > (b) ? (a) : (b)) | 213 | #define MAX(a,b) ((a) > (b) ? (a) : (b)) |
214 | -- | 214 | -- |
215 | 2.24.1 | 215 | 2.26.2 |
216 | 216 | ||